Yeong-cheol, whose real name is Park Jae-hong, was born in 1990, making him 35 years old in 2025. He is a talented individual who graduated from Yonsei University's Department of Physical Education. Since his school days, he's showcased remarkable athletic abilities. His revelation of playing professional football for Bucheon FC in the K League 2 surprised many. The strong mental fortitude and physical strength honed through competition in the professional world were evident in his struggles in Solo Hell. After his athletic career, he is now appearing before the public again through 'NaSolSaGae', showing a new side of himself.
Yeong-cheol's personality, as portrayed in the show, initially appeared quite serious and cautious. However, over time, he displayed a candid and occasionally unexpected clumsiness. For example, many viewers were surprised when he revealed his hobby of playing the piano, despite having only studied for three months, contrasting his tough exterior. He repeatedly mentioned his ideal type as someone with a feminine aura and a bright disposition. He specifically named Hyun-suk from Season 11 and Ok-sun from Season 17 as his ideal types from past seasons of Solo Hell, creating significant buzz. This firm ideal type served as an important guidepost in his romantic journey.

After the main season of Solo Hell 25 ended, Yeong-cheol appeared on 'NaSolSaGae' (NaSol Four Seasons), continuing his search for love. His appearance on 'NaSolSaGae' generated anticipation among many fans, as it allowed for the continuation of the unfinished parts of his story from the main season. In NaSolSaGae, he continued his efforts to find someone close to his ideal type by interacting with new female participants. A meeting with a specific participant he had mentioned as his ideal type in the main season created significant interest.
On 'NaSolSaGae', Yeong-cheol's interaction with Ok-sun from Season 17, whom he previously mentioned as his ideal type, garnered considerable attention. He couldn't hide his excitement at her appearance, expressing that it felt like a dream. Amidst growing interest in the development of their relationship, a recent preview revealed a shocking change of heart for Yeong-cheol. Having previously seemed committed to his 'one and only ideal type', his sudden remark of wanting to get to know other women, alongside scenes of a close conversation with another female participant, has intensified curiosity about the upcoming episodes.
